More results...
Home » Gifts » Page 84
Showing 665–672 of 686 resultsSorted by price: low to high
SKU:ECKO4738
SKU:ECKO4742
SKU:ECKO4744
SKU:ECKO4739
SKU:ECKO4740XX
SKU:ECKO4728
SKU:ECKO4741
SKU:ECKO47C6
Shipping only available within South Africa
Choose Collect if unsure and contact shipping@ecko.africa 0101100350